Show moreImmerse yourself in the enchanting world of the Wizarding World with Harry Potter – A History of Magic: The Book of the Exhibition. This beautifully crafted hardcover volume serves as one of the official books published to complement the captivating 'A History of Magic' exhibition held at the British Library. Compiled in collaboration with Bloomsbury and J.K. Rowling, this extraordinary book brings to life the historical roots of magic through rich illustrations, captivating artifacts, and behind-the-scenes insights from the creation of the Harry Potter series. In comparison with its counterparts, such as Harry Potter - A Journey Through A History of Magic, this larger Bloomsbury edition offers an extensive collection of artifacts and more details from the exhibition. While the smaller paperback version caters specifically to family audiences, the hardcover edition is designed for readers who desire a deeper dive into both magical and real-world history, making it a more valuable investment for serious fans and collectors.
